2009 PLC (C.S.) 662

AZIZ-UR-REHMAN vs FEDERATION OF PAKISTAN, ISLAMABAD through

Citation2009 PLC (C.S.) 662
CourtSindh High Court
Case No.Constitutional Petition No,D-1055 of 2005
Date2007-11-27
Judge(s)Munib Ahmed Khan, Rana Muhammad Shamim
ResultPetition dismissed

ORDER

1. ' The petitioner through this petition has contended that an enquiry in pursuance of the charge- sheet dated 13-2-2007, which is being conducted at Turbat, is to be transferred from that place to other place. Learned counsel for the respondents and the learned D.A.G. Have strongly opposed the request by stating that fraud, embezzlement and malpractices have been charged, which are mentioned in the charge-sheet and they are in respect of the working place of the petitioner which is Turbat vis-a-vis. The Bank Branch at Turbat, while witnesses are also available at that place.

2. After hearing the learned counsel, it appears that the petition is not maintainable and misconceived. This Court, in Constitutional jurisdiction cannot transfer the enquiry as per desire of the petitioner. Hence this petition is dismissed in limine with costs of Rs,5,000.
